In the 1970s she became a standout figure with her memorable performances in timeless classics like «The Godfather» and the «Rocky» franchise. Her legendary characters as Connie and Adrian solidified her status as a standout figure in the industry. They even earned her Oscar nominations and worldwide recognition.  There is no denying that she has become the era’s most respected actresses.

Her collaboration with her brother, director Francis Ford Coppola was a turning point in her drizzling career. Gradually, she stepped away from her career for the sake of her family. Together with her second husband, producer Jack Schwartzman, the star founded a production company. Shire chose to explore the other sides of the film industry. In some time, the star returned to acting with her roles in «Kingdom» and «Dreamland» directed by her son Robert.

Her personal life was also fraught with challenges and hardship. Her husband’s passing in 1994 became a turning point in her life hitting her like a sharp knife. The actress kept him in her heart and memory. Of course, it was extremely hard for her to raise 5 children entirely on her own navigating such a tough and challenging period of her life with resilience and dignity.

Her recent guest appearance on the hit series «Abbott Elementary» was memorable too. It is worth noting that she even set a home-based school for her grandchildren. Despite all the stardom, she has remained one of the most down-to-earth and grounded actresses.
